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• the effect of the development on the architectural integrity of the host property and thereby the character and appearance of the street scene
  • whether the proposal would cause harm to the living conditions of neighbouring residential occupiers in terms of a loss of privacy

What decided it

The proposal would cause harm to the architectural integrity of the host property and the character and appearance of the street scene by introducing an incongruous and dominant contemporary form that fails to respect the existing vernacular character and local patterns of development.

Plan policies cited: Policy PP27
